Default Re: Eurovox 2 i think flashed wrong - remote now don't work...

I think you have lost the scart connection
connect some coax cable from the TV / VCR socket of the eurovox to the TV
tune your telly to the VCR channel where you will get the 'enter pin' screen
using your remote enter the master pin which is 1004.
go to menu and clear data, then do a factory reset.
plug your scart back in and do a powerscan as normal
